Strong Hebrew #3904 - לְחֵנָה lechenah
Strong's Exhaustive Concordance concubine (Aramaic) from an unused root of uncertain meaning; a concubine -- concubine. Englishman's Concordance 1) concubine Part of Speech: noun feminine A Related Word by BDB/Strong’s Number: from an unused root of uncertain meaning Same Word by TWOT Number: 2815 Brown-Driver-Briggs [לְחֵנָה] noun feminineconcubine (ᵑ7לְחֵינְתָא; FlLevy NHWB ii. 534 f. compare Arabic , indelicate epithet for woman; BattenEzra 2:65 compare Arabic note, tune, song; still otherwise WetzstDe, HL u. Koh. 454); — plural suffix לְחֵנָתָךְDaniel 5:23, הֵּ֯Daniel 5:2; Daniel 5:3.
